
European Union funding
European Union funding refers to financial support provided by the EU to member countries, organizations, and projects to promote economic growth, social development, research, and infrastructure. This funding helps address regional disparities, support innovation, and achieve common goals like sustainability and employment. Funds are allocated through programs and grants, with specific criteria and oversight, ensuring they are used effectively to benefit communities and advance the EU’s overall objectives. Essentially, it’s a way for member states to collaborate financially on initiatives that might be too large or costly for any one country alone.
